Texting Photos

Sparkbooth 4 or later has the option to send text messages or photos to a mobile phone. A Premium license is required to use the feature. So you can either send the photo (MMS) or a text message with the download link to the photo (SMS). This feature requires either a Twilio, Vivial Connect, Vonage, or Telnyx.

Note: You will not be able to send texts until you have had your account verified by the service provider (Twlio, Vivial Connect, etc) due to A2P 10DLC regulation.

Using Twilio

Twilio account is a paid service. Please check with Twilio for pricing.

  1. Sign up for a Twilio account, and purchase either a telephone number or short code from Twilio.
  2. Sign into your Twilio account and copy your account SID and Auth Token
    sparkbooth-twilio.jpg
  3. Open Sparkbooth and go to Settings, then Photo Booth, GIF Booth, or Mirror Booth, and select Send To Guest
  4. Enable Send to Guest
  5. Enable Mobile and select Twilio
  6. Enter your Twilio SID and Token, and press Login button
    Sign into Twilio service
  7. Select the Twilio telelphone or shortcode you want to use
    Setup texting settings
  8. Change the telephone number mask for your country's telephone number. Include the country code and use # as the number placeholder. In the US, if you want limit the area code use 1-555-###-#### so people can only enter mobile phone numbers in the 555 area code (use your area code instead of 555). You can disable the telephone mask by uncheck the checkbox in front of it.
  9. If you have a picture capable telephone or short code, you can send the photo instead of a link to the uploaded photo.
  10. Change the caption to include some text with the photo or link
  11. Change the "Upload to" for the service you want to use to host of photo upload.
  12. You now have texting setup for Sparkbooth. You can press the Test button to try it out

Using Vivial Connect

Vivial Connect is a paid service. Please check with Vivial Connect for pricing.

  1. Open Sparkbooth and go to Settings, then Photo Booth, GIF Booth, or Mirror Booth, select Send To Guest, enable Send to Mobile and select VivialConnect. Check if the settings require an Access Token, or API Key and Secret
  2. Sign up for a Vivial Connect account.
  3. Sign into your Vivial Connect account
  4. Go to Numbers to purchase a telephone number
  5. Click on your account name to expand the menu
  6. If Sparkbooth needs an Access Token:
    • Click Access Tokens menu item
    • Click New Tokens to create a new personal access token
    • For Token Scope, select Messages and Numbers
    • Click Create Token to finish
    • Copy the access token value
  7. If Sparkbooth needs an API Key and Secret
    • Click API Keys menu item
    • Click New API Key
    • Copy the API Key and Secret values,
    • Click Save & Close
  8. Open Sparkbooth and go to Settings, then Photo Booth, GIF Booth, or Mirror Booth, and select Send To Guest
  9. Enable Send to Guest
  10. Enable Mobile and select Vivial Connect
  11. Enter your Vivial Connet Account ID, Access Token or API Key and Secret, and press Login button
  12. Select whether you want to SMS or MMS service, and the telephone number to use
    Sparkbooth_Vivial_Connect_setup.jpg
  13. Change the telephone number mask for your country's telephone number. Include the country code and use # as the number placeholder. In the US, if you want limit the area code use 1-555-###-#### so people can only enter mobile phone numbers in the 555 area code (use your area code instead of 555). You can disable the telephone mask by uncheck the checkbox in front of it.
  14. Change the caption to include some text with the photo or link
  15. Change the "Upload to" for the service you want to use to host of photo upload if you are using the SMS service
  16. You now have texting setup for Sparkbooth. You can press the Test button to try it out

Using Vonage

Vonage account is a paid service. Please check with Vonage for pricing.

  1. Sign up for a Vonage account, and purchase either a telephone number or short code.
  2. Sign into your Vonage account and copy your API credentials key and secret
    Nexmo_Dashboard.jpg
  3. Open Sparkbooth and go to Settings, then Photo Booth, GIF Booth, or Mirror Booth, and select Send To Guest
  4. Enable Send to Guest
  5. Enable Mobile and select Vonage
  6. Enter your Vonage Key and Secret, and press Login button
    Sparkbooth_Nexmo_login.jpg
  7. Select the telelphone or shortcode you want to use
    Sparkbooth_Nexmo_logged_in.jpg
  8. Change the telephone number mask for your country's telephone number. Include the country code and use # as the number placeholder. In the US, if you want limit the area code use 1-555-###-#### so people can only enter mobile phone numbers in the 555 area code (use your area code instead of 555). You can disable the telephone mask by uncheck the checkbox in front of it.
  9. If you have a picture capable telephone or short code, you can send the photo instead of a link to the uploaded photo.
  10. Change the caption to include some text with the photo or link
  11. Change the "Upload to" for the service you want to use to host of photo upload.
  12. You now have texting setup for Sparkbooth. You can press the Test button to try it out

Using Telnyx

Telnyx is a paid service. Please check with Telnyx for pricing.

  1. Sign up for a Telnyx account.
  2. Sign into your Telnyx account
  3. Go to Numbers to purchase a telephone number
  4. Click the Messaging icon for your telephone number to create a messaging profile
    telnyx_messaging_icon.jpg
  5. Under SMS Messaging, click the list and select "Create new Messaging Profile" to create and assign a profile to the telephone number. You can update the settings of the profile later under Messaging
    telnyx_create_profile.jpg
  6. Click the Auth menu item, select Auth V2 tab, and then Create API Key to create an API key. Copy the API Key (not the ID).
    telnyx_create_key.jpg
  7. Open Sparkbooth and go to Settings, then Photo Booth, GIF Booth, or Mirror Booth, and select Send To Guest
  8. Enable Send to Guest
  9. Enable Mobile and select Telnyx
  10. Enter API Key and press Login button
    Sparkbooth_telnyx.jpg
  11. Select whether you want to SMS or MMS service, and the telephone number to use
    Sparkbooth_telnyx_setup.jpg
  12. Change the telephone number mask for your country's telephone number. Include the country code and use # as the number placeholder. In the US, if you want limit the area code use 1-555-###-#### so people can only enter mobile phone numbers in the 555 area code (use your area code instead of 555). You can disable the telephone mask by uncheck the checkbox in front of it.
  13. Change the caption to include some text with the photo or link
  14. Change the "Upload to" for the service you want to use to host of photo upload if you are using the SMS service
  15. You now have texting setup for Sparkbooth. You can press the Test button to try it out
